The activity, organized by Ibiza and Formentera Preservation with support from Ibiza Blue Challenge, will be held on Saturday, May 17, at Ses Illetes beach
April 11, 2025 – On the occasion of World Recycling Day , Ibiza and Formentera Preservation and Ibiza Blue Challenge are launching for the first time in the Pitiusa Minor the free family gymkhana ‘Formentera Recycles!’ , a fun and educational initiative that will take place on Saturday, May 17, from 11: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. , on Ses Illetes beach, near Sa Sèquía .
The activity is supported by the Formentera Council, the band Depeche Mode, and the watch brand Hublot, through their charitable partnership with Conservation Collective. The event also includes support from Trasmapi, Soul Water, Radio Illa, The Other Face , and Gecko Beach Club Formentera.
Registration is now open and can be done free of charge through the Sportmaniacs website until Friday, May 16 at 11:00 a.m. , or until the 100 available spots are filled.
This competition has a similar format to the one held over the last three years in Ibiza, which has been very well received. Its objective is to “raise awareness about recycling and the circular economy in a fun way through an orienteering race,” explains Jordi Salewski, coordinator of the Circular Economy program at the environmental foundation. To do this, teams, made up of two or three people, at least one of them an adult, must solve 12 clues hidden in the surroundings , guided by a map provided by the organizers. This activity is suitable for all ages, with each group adapting the pace to their level.
“We want to celebrate this day by promoting environmental commitment through fun and learning as a family. We’re excited to bring this activity to Formentera for the first time and hope that many local people will participate in defense of the islands’ natural environment and a circular model that minimizes waste and promotes reuse and proper recycling,” says Inma Saranova , director of IbizaPreservation.
In addition to enjoying a day outdoors and raising awareness about recycling, all teams that complete the course will receive a gift of local products . The three fastest teams will also receive a basket of local products , and excursions will be raffled off among all participants, courtesy of the event’s partners.
“The goal is twofold: to offer a fun family experience and to promote values such as sustainability and respect for our environment,” highlights Juanjo Serra , CEO of Ibiza Blue Challenge , the entity responsible for the gymkhana’s logistics.
The event organizers also announced that refreshment points will be set up with recyclable materials and separate containers to ensure responsible waste management throughout the event.
